Shipping Information

Shipping Information for Small Shipments

SELA uses FedEx parcel for small packages and shipments of 6 or fewer total packages, unless the weight/dimension does not allow.

Shipping charges may be prepaid and add (PPA) with credit approval OR billed to the customer’s account, written authorization required on P.O.

If expedited service is required then written authorization will be required and then billed to the customers FedEx account.

For UPS service, a call tag will need to be placed with UPS and then billed to the customer’s account, as SELA does not work with UPS.

 

Shipping Information for Skids or Large Items

SELA has steeply discounted freight rates that have been negotiated with a wide variety of LTL (Less Than Truckload) carriers to provide service across the US with various levels of service and PPA charges added to invoice.

Weights and dimensions are also available upon request for customer’s to secure their own freight service, billed to their own account.

Dedicated PUP service is sometimes available for 12 skids or more.

Dedicated service for TL (Truck Load) service typically requires 18-26 skids.

 

International Freight

International freight service should be arranged via your freight forwarder with all shipping documents e-mailed to SELA at sales@selainc.com, with charges billed to your company. Product must be paid for prior to shipment.
